PLYMOUTH, Wis. (WHBL) – A man is hospitalized after a rollover crash in the Town of Plymouth Tuesday night. The Sheboygan County Sheriff’s Department says they were called to Highway 67 near County S around 5pm – the driver of an eastbound car lost control of the vehicle, it left the road, rolled, and threw the 29 year old man from the vehicle. After he was taken to Aurora Hospital in Grafton, he was airlifted to Froedert in Milwaukee where he’s in critical condition. There is no indication of foul play, alcohol and speed were not factors.
